| - What can be better than an underground tiki bar on a Sunday night? I came here with two friends around 630 pm and we were lucky enough to snag three seats at the bar. UnderTow is tiny, with a U-shaped bar top and a few small tables, so I definitely wouldn't recommend coming with a big group. The ambiance is incredible - you feel like you're immediately transported to a tiki paradise, complete with scheduled thunderstorms and gorgeous ocean/horizon videos playing through portholes in the walls. Their menu alone is a work of art; the illustrations are awesome and there's a fun short story in the first few pages if you have a few minutes to read it!
So I'm not the biggest fan of rum (I know, blasphemy!) but there's definitely a good variety of cocktails to choose from. I had the Smoking Cannon on a friend's recommendation, and it was AMAZING. It was like a tiki twist an old fashioned - bourbon, rum, sherry, pineapple bitters, and topped with cinnamon smoke. I also fangirled a bit over their ice cubes - huge, perfect, clear, gorgeous cubes! Unfortunately they had another party coming in right after us, so we only got to stay for one drink, but I would definitely be back, and will probably make a reservation next time!
